Taiwan Express Holdings Announces Cumulative Acquisition of Same Securities Reaching 20% of Paid-in Capital

- Taiwan Express Holdings has announced the cumulative acquisition of Evergreen Marine Corporation shares, reaching 20% of its paid-in capital. The total transaction amount was approximately NT$291.332 million, with a shareholding ratio of 0.41%, aiming to enhance capital utilization efficiency.

Frequently Asked Questions
- Q: How many shares of Evergreen Marine does Taiwan Express Holdings own?
- A: It owns a total of 8.8 million shares, representing 0.41% of voting rights.
- Q: What is the purpose of this investment?
- A: To enhance capital efficiency by investing in a stable, dividend-paying company.
- Q: How many pledged shares are there in this holding?
- A: 5 million shares are pledged, accounting for about 57% of the total holdings.
- Q: What is the financial impact of this investment?
- A: It accounts for 24.66% of total assets and 44.91% of equity, significantly affecting the balance sheet.
- Q: Is this a related-party transaction?
- A: No, the counterparty is unrelated, and the transaction was conducted fairly.
